How To Fix STC_CONT_CFG_ENTITY279 - &1 &2 Parameter for Task ID = &3 not used in Content


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: STC_CONT_CFG_ENTITY - Technical Configuration Entity Messages

  • Message number: 279

  • Message text: &1 &2 Parameter for Task ID = &3 not used in Content

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message STC_CONT_CFG_ENTITY279 - &1 &2 Parameter for Task ID = &3 not used in Content ?

    The SAP error message STC_CONT_CFG_ENTITY279 indicates that there is a configuration issue related to a task in the SAP system. Specifically, it suggests that a parameter for a specific task ID is not being utilized in the content configuration. This can occur in various scenarios, particularly when dealing with SAP Solution Manager or during the configuration of background jobs or tasks.

    Cause:

    1. Unused Parameters: The error typically arises when a task is defined with parameters that are not referenced or used in the content configuration. This can happen if the task was modified or if the content was not updated accordingly.
    2. Content Mismatch: There may be a mismatch between the task definition and the content that is supposed to utilize it. This can occur after updates or changes in the system.
    3. Incorrect Task ID: The task ID specified may not correspond to any valid configuration or may have been deleted or altered.

    Solution:

    1. Review Task Configuration: Check the configuration of the task associated with the specified Task ID. Ensure that all parameters are correctly defined and that they are being used in the content.
    2. Update Content: If the task has been modified, ensure that the content is updated to reflect these changes. This may involve re-importing or adjusting the content configuration.
    3. Check for Dependencies: Verify if there are any dependencies or prerequisites that need to be fulfilled for the task to function correctly.
    4.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to the specific task or content package to ensure that all configurations are in line with SAP standards.
    5.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ists, consider reaching out to SAP support for assistance, especially if this is affecting critical business processes.
